About This Work
Riding Solo commands attention through scale alone — at 30 × 48 inches, this is a painting built for a significant wall, a work that asks to be the centre of a room. A solitary rider moving through open landscape: the image is elemental, unhurried, and deeply American. Reiner understands that the Western landscape is never merely scenery — it is protagonist, pressing in on the figure with its vastness, its silence, and its particular quality of light.
There is a meditative quality to Riding Solo that sets it apart from more dramatic Western subjects. This is not a painting of conflict or spectacle but of solitude — the rider and the land in a relationship of mutual indifference and quiet belonging. It is the kind of painting that rewards long looking, revealing new passages of colour and atmosphere as the eye moves across its generous surface.
About the Artist
Richard Reiner is a contemporary American painter specialising in Western subjects — landscapes, figures, and the living history of the American West. His work is characterised by strong draughtsmanship, atmospheric colour, and a deep familiarity with his subject matter.
